Stop setting the same goals if you can.

If the goal is set, "never achieved."

Let's go from setting goals → to questioning yourself instead.

Because maybe we're not missing "goals."

But we lack "direction and self-understanding."

---

✏️ changed from "to make it" → to "to know something first."

❌ will lose 5 kilos ➡️ ✔️ What behavior will cause weight loss today?

❌ will save 5,000 ➡️ ✔️ per salary. If you save 5,000, what does life have to cut?

❌ will wake up at 5 a.m. every day ➡️ ✔️ What is the reason why we can't wake up?

---

🔄 five conscious questions that help the target become "possible."

Why is this goal important to me?

If I succeed, how will my life change?

If you fail, what is the most convincing reason?

To start tomorrow, what only needs to be prepared?

What's the smallest thing it can do?

---

⭐ Change the word "have to do it."

Let's say that...

It's good to take one step today.

Don't start big.

Just start "doing it."

---

🔖 if targeted and never achieved

Don't try to pressure yourself with the words "have to make it."

But start asking yourself, "What do you need to know first to start on the right track?"
